Several factors are driving the growth of the harvest conditioners market. The rising global population necessitates increased food production, pushing farmers to adopt technologies that optimize yields and minimize losses. Harvest conditioners directly address these needs by improving crop quality and efficiency during harvest. Simultaneously, technological advancements are creating more efficient and effective machines. Improvements in threshing mechanisms, gentler handling of crops to minimize damage, and enhanced automation capabilities are making harvest conditioners increasingly attractive to farmers. Government initiatives and subsidies aimed at promoting agricultural modernization and improving farming practices in many countries are also stimulating market demand. Furthermore, the increasing awareness among farmers regarding the economic benefits associated with reducing post-harvest losses is further propelling the adoption of these machines. The growth of contract farming and large-scale agricultural operations also significantly contributes to the demand for high-throughput harvest conditioners. The overall trend towards precision agriculture, with its emphasis on data-driven decision-making and optimized resource utilization, creates a favorable environment for the continued expansion of the harvest conditioners market.
Despite the positive market outlook, several challenges and restraints could hinder the growth of the harvest conditioners market. High initial investment costs can be a significant barrier for smallholder farmers, particularly in developing countries, limiting their access to this technology. The complexity of operating and maintaining these sophisticated machines requires specialized training and skilled labor, which might not always be readily available. Fluctuations in raw material prices and overall economic instability can influence the cost of production and potentially impact market growth. Stringent environmental regulations and concerns about the environmental impact of agricultural machinery can influence the development and adoption of new technologies. Furthermore, the competitive landscape, with many manufacturers vying for market share, can lead to price wars and reduced profit margins. Lastly, technological advancements in other areas of agriculture might offer alternative solutions to some of the challenges currently addressed by harvest conditioners, potentially impacting market growth in the long term. Overcoming these challenges requires collaboration between manufacturers, governments, and farmers to find innovative solutions and make this technology more accessible and affordable.
